I am a licensed professional counselor with thirteen years experience. I am eclectic in practice, but have a strong bent toward cognitive behavioral and narrative therapy styles. My approach is client-centered as it is the client’s process and journey; I have the honor of being, only, a part of that. I believe in the power of one’s story to heal and overcome.

I have worked with clients, ranging in age, from eleven to eighty-two. The majority of the people I have worked with have been adults. I enjoy working with people from all walks of life. Many of my clients have been from the LGBTQ+ community. I have worked with both victims (survivors) and offenders. I have worked with individuals, small groups, and larger groups. I love every kind of person and I believe in the power and beauty of humanity.

Is Online Therapy the Right Fit for Your Needs?

Many people wonder whether virtual counseling can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, or navigating life transitions, online therapy has been shown to be just as effective as traditional in-person treatment.

A major benefit of remote therapy is flexibility. Clients can choose the mode of connection that works best for them – video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ging – which often makes it easier to include therapy in a busy schedule.

Licensed professionals provide online therapy, and if a client decides they would prefer a different fit, it is possible to switch therapists. For many people, the combination of effectiveness and convenience makes online therapy a practical option for addressing everyday mental health concerns.
